Partilhar via


sys.dm_xe_session_event_actions (Transact-SQL)

Aplica-se a: Instância Gerenciada de SQL do Azure do SQL Server

Retorna informações sobre ações de sessão de evento para sessões ativas no escopo do servidor. Quando eventos são disparados, são executadas ações.

O Banco de Dados SQL do Azure dá suporte apenas a sessões com escopo de banco de dados. Veja sys.dm_xe_database_session_event_actions.

Nome da coluna Tipo de dados Descrição
event_session_address varbinary(8) O endereço da memória da sessão de evento. Não permite valor nulo.
action_name nvarchar(256) O nome da ação. Não permite valor nulo.
action_package_guid uniqueidentifier A GUID para o pacote que contém esta ação. Não permite valor nulo.
event_name nvarchar(256) O nome do evento ao qual a ação está associada. Não permite valor nulo.
event_package_guid uniqueidentifier O GUID do pacote que contém o evento. Não permite valor nulo.

Permissões

, é necessário ter permissão VIEW SERVER STATE no servidor.

Permissões do SQL Server 2022 e posteriores

É necessária a permissão VIEW SERVER PERFORMANCE STATE no servidor.

Cardinalidades de relações

De Para Relação
sys.dm_xe_session_event_actions.event_session_address sys.dm_xe_sessions.address Muitos para um
sys.dm_xe_session_event_actions.nome_da_ação,

sys.dm_xe_session_event_actions.action_package_guid
sys.dm_xe_objects.name,

sys.dm_xe_session_events.event_package_guid
Muitos para um
sys.dm_xe_session_event_actions.nome_do_evento,

sys.dm_xe_session_event_actions.event_package_guid
sys.dm_xe_objects.name,

sys.dm_xe_objects.package_guid
Muitos para um

Próximas etapas

Saiba mais sobre conceitos relacionados nos seguintes artigos: